Popular Nigerian lawyer and entertainment expert, Ayo Shonaiya, has shared his thoughts on the recent drama between Speed Darlington and NAPTIP. According to him, Speed Darlington may actually have a legal point in the way he’s handling the situation.
Speed Darlington had earlier posted a video saying he would not respond to NAPTIP’s invitation. He was asked to come in for questioning after making certain comments in one of his videos. These comments were seen as promoting or joking about human trafficking, which is what NAPTIP focuses on preventing.
However, Ayo Shonaiya explained that from a legal angle, Speed’s refusal to honor the invitation might not be wrong. He said that even though Speed Darlington used strong and rude words in his video, legally, he does not have to show up unless a proper legal process is followed—like getting a court order or a formal charge.
Shonaiya added that people may not like Speed Darlington’s attitude, but when it comes to the law, everyone must be treated fairly, even if their behavior is annoying. He also reminded the public that no one should be forced to appear before a government agency without proper legal steps.
